Katla Ice Cave Highlights

Mýrdalsjökull Glacier

Nestled beneath Iceland’s Mýrdalsjökull glacier, Katla Ice Cave is an enchanting natural wonder named after the nearby Katla Volcano.

Regarded as one of Iceland’s most stunning ice caves, its allure lies in the ever-changing colors and intricate patterns etched into the ancient ice walls, shaped over centuries by nature’s forces.

Inside Katla Ice Cave

Inside the cave, a mesmerizing play of light takes place as sunlight filters through the translucent ice, creating a magical dance of colors and shadows that transforms the space into an ethereal landscape.

Visitors walk through shimmering tunnels and caves, marveling at the awe-inspiring black ash ice from different volcanic eruptions of Katla Volcano, as well as glittering ice formations with blue ice and trapped air bubbles.


Dragon Glass Cave

The ice cave’s allure is further enhanced by its appearance in the Game of Thrones series, earning it the affectionate nickname Dragon Glass Cave.

This otherworldly scenery makes Katla Ice Cave a truly exceptional bucket-list destination, well worth a visit to experience the beauty of Iceland’s glacial spectacle.

Although Katla Ice Cave can be visited year-round, the best time to experience its mesmerizing beauty is during winter, from late October to March. During this period, the ice caves reveal their enchanting beauty, offering a safe and captivating exploration.

Katla Ice Cave is located in South Iceland, beneath the Kötlujökull Glacier. This is an outlet of Mýrdalsjökull Glacier, the fourth largest glacier in Iceland. Mýrdalsjökull Glacier covers the mighty Katla, one of Iceland’s most active volcanoes.

Most guided tours to Katla Ice Cave commence from the charming Icelandic village of Vík í Mýrdal, approximately a 2.5-hour car drive from Reykjavík.

Alternatively, you can conveniently reach Vík from Reykjavík by taking bus service number 51, departing from Mjodd in Reykjavik.

Katla Ice Cave Tours are suitable for a wide range of adventurers with moderate physical fitness, including families, solo travelers, and nature enthusiasts.

However, individuals afraid of the dark or suffering from claustrophobia may find the tour challenging.

Additionally, depending on the operator, the tour may not be available for children under 6 or 8 years of
age.

Yes, visiting the Katla Ice Cave requires joining a guided tour. The cave is located on a glacier within an active volcanic area, and access is only possible with certified guides, proper equipment, and specially adapted vehicles.

The walk to Katla Ice Cave is relatively short and manageable for most travelers. After a Super Jeep ride across rugged terrain, the glacier hike usually takes around 10–20 minutes each way, depending on ice conditions and the cave’s location.

Yes, Katla Ice Cave tours are designed with safety as a top priority. Professional glacier guides assess conditions daily, provide helmets and crampons, and select only naturally formed ice caves that are safe to enter at the time of the visit.

Absolutely. Photography is allowed and encouraged inside the Katla Ice Cave. The striking blue and black ice formations offer incredible photo opportunities, and guides usually allow enough time inside the cave to capture memorable shots.

Katla Ice Cave can be visited year-round, unlike many other ice caves in Iceland. Winter offers deeper colors and a more classic ice cave feel, while summer provides easier access and unique contrasts between ice, volcanic ash, and surrounding landscapes. Read More Here

Exploring Katla Ice Cave on your own is strongly advised against due to extreme dangers, such as slipping, falling into hidden crevasses, or encountering falling ice chunks. To access the cave safely, specific gear like crampons and helmets are necessary, and driving there requires a specialized all-terrain 4×4 vehicle. For a safe and enriching experience, always opt for a guided tour with knowledgeable and experienced glacier guides.
